1. The New Reality of Dynamic Pricing
At its core, dynamic pricing is the practice of adjusting product prices in real time based on market demand, customer behavior, and competitive pressures. In the context of Shopify, this concept has evolved into a much more sophisticated strategy. It's no longer just about raising prices during peak demand; it's about creating personalized offers triggered by shopper intent and even introducing negotiation mechanisms that mimic the in-store haggling experience.
But on Shopify, it’s evolving into something more:
Static pricing = missed revenue. If you always give the same 20% coupon, you’re leaving money on the table. Some customers would’ve purchased at 10%, while others abandon if not offered 25%.
So static discounts are dead. Dynamic, AI-driven negotiation is the future of Shopify conversions.

2. Five Ways to Implement Dynamic Pricing in Shopify (Step-by-Step)
Moving from theory to practice is crucial for unlocking the benefits of dynamic pricing. Here are five actionable methods you can implement on your Shopify store.
a. Segment-Based Pricing
Not all customers are the same, so your pricing shouldn't be either. Segment-based pricing involves tailoring offers to different customer groups. For example, you might provide first-time shoppers with a negotiation-enabled offer to encourage their first purchase, while loyal customers receive exclusive bundles or early access to sales. This approach makes each customer feel valued and increases the likelihood of conversion.
b. Real-Time Cart Negotiation
Inspired by the DBargain model, real-time cart negotiation allows shoppers to bargain for a better price directly at checkout. This proactive strategy recovers potentially abandoned carts in the moment, eliminating the need for follow-up emails that are often ignored. By giving customers a sense of control, you create a positive and engaging shopping experience that fosters loyalty.
c. Time-Sensitive Discounts
Creating a sense of urgency can be a powerful motivator. Time-sensitive discounts involve adjusting prices dynamically for flash sales or offering a limited-time negotiation window to close a deal. For example, you could offer a 15-minute window for a shopper to negotiate a price, prompting a quick decision and reducing the chance of cart abandonment.
d. Demand-Driven Adjustments
This classic dynamic pricing strategy involves adjusting prices based on product popularity and inventory levels. If a product starts trending, the price can be adjusted upward to capitalize on high demand. Conversely, if inventory is moving slowly, a dynamic markdown can be triggered to clear stock. This ensures your pricing remains competitive and responsive to market changes.
e. Personalized Dynamic Pricing with AI
The most advanced form of dynamic pricing uses AI to predict the lowest acceptable discount for each individual shopper. AI tools like DBargain apply real-time negotiation rules—such as not dropping below a 15% profit margin—to ensure that you offer an attractive deal without sacrificing profitability. This level of personalization maximizes conversions while protecting your bottom line.

6. The Future of E-Commerce Is Negotiation
Customers today don’t just want a discount; they want to feel a sense of control and the satisfaction of "winning" a deal. Static coupon codes have lost their excitement, leading to what can be described as coupon fatigue. AI-powered negotiation taps directly into this human psychology. Even if the final negotiated price is the same as a standard discount, the perceived value is much higher because the shopper actively participated in securing it.
This shift marks the next era of e-commerce, where AI agents become the digital sales representatives for online stores. While competitor-based pricing tools are reactive, AI negotiation is proactive, engaging and converting shoppers at the critical moment of purchase.
